#07043f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#07043f is composed of 2.7% red, 1.6%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.9% cyan, 93.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 75.3% black. It has a hue angle of 243.1 degrees, a saturation of 88.1% and a lightness of 13.1%. #07043f color hex could be obtained by blending #0e087e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

Shades and Tints of #07043f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010008 is the darkest color, while #f5f4fe is the lightest one.
